Yingli Green Energy (NYSE: YGE) reported Q4 EPS of ($7.20), $5.72 worse than the analyst estimate of ($1.48). Revenue for the quarter came in at $325.7 million versus the consensus estimate of $372.3 million.
Total photovoltaic ("PV") module shipments1 were 504.5 MW1, increased from 460.4 MW1 in the third quarter of 2015, well above the Company's previous guidance of 420 MW to 440 MW.
Debt Restructuring and Introduction of Strategic Investors
The Company's subsidiaries are exploring various potential debt restructuring options in order to improve theirs liquidity and debt-to-equity ratio and reduce cash outflow from debt repayments. In particular, the Company's subsidiaries have been proactively negotiating with main bank creditors and holders of their medium-term notes ("MTNs") to try to find viable solutions. The Company understands that these bank creditors and holders of MTNs as well as the relevant state, provincial and municipal government authorities are aware of the difficulties in repayment of such debts and have expressed their understanding and continuous support. The Company and its subsidiaries are also negotiating proactively with potential strategic investors for potential strategic investments in the Company or its subsidiaries. Such debt restructuring and strategic investments, if successfully completed, will further increase the Company and its subsidiaries' liquidity and improve their debt-to-equity ratio.
Update on Repayment of Medium-Term Notes
Tianwei Yingli, a major subsidiary of the Company, repaid approximately 70% of the RMB denominated unsecured five-year medium-term notes of RMB1.0 billion (the "2010 MTNs") when they became due on October 13, 2015, and has RMB denominated unsecured five-year medium-term notes of RMB1.4 billion (the "2011 MTNs") due on May 12, 2016. As disclosed in the Company's press release dated April 6, 2016, Tianwei Yingli informed holders of the 2011 MTNs that it would be very difficult for Tianwei Yingli to repay the 2011 MTNs on the due date and Tianwei Yingli proposed to extend the repayment date by two to three years; and holders of the 2010 MTNs demanded Tianwei Yingli to repay the remaining portion of the 2010 MTNs in full together with accrued interests before May 12, 2016. Tianwei Yingli expects to be unable to repay the 2011 MTNs or the 2010 MTNs on May 12, 2016, and is still in the process of actively discussing with the holders of the 2011 MTNs and the 2010 MTNs about potential extension of the repayment dates of both MTNs. The Company is exploring various alternative financing plans for repayment of both MTNs such as: 1) introduction of strategic investors to invest into the Company and the Company's subsidiaries, 2) introduction of new creditors to grant new borrowings to the Company or the Company's subsidiaries, and 3) sales of certain long-lived assets including land use rights to obtain additional funds.
Liquidating Land Use Right Held by Hainan Yingli
On November 5, 2015, Hainan Yingli entered into a Capital Increase Agreement with its shareholder Haikou National, pursuant to which Haikou National used its land use rights to subscribe for newly issued equity interests in Hainan Yingli and Hainan Yingli is required to repurchase such equity interests from Haikou National in three installments within 10 years at an aggregate price equal to the fair market value of the land use rights on the date of the agreement plus interests calculated at the prevailing bank loan interest rate in China. Hainan Yingli subsequently disposed of the land use rights contributed by Haikou National by transferring to a third party 100% equity interest in its wholly owned subsidiary that held the land use rights (the "Hainan Land Disposal"). As of the date hereof, the Hainan Land Disposal is substantially completed while the parties are in the process of completing remaining administrative procedures. Hainan Yingli received RMB 265.0 million as partial consideration for the Hainan Land Disposal in 2015 and expects to receive the remaining portion of the consideration in the amount of RMB 470.0 million in 2016.
Business Outlook for First Quarter and Fiscal Year 2016
Based on current market conditions, the Company's current operating conditions, estimated production capacity and forecasted customer demand, the Company expects its PV module shipments to be in the estimated range of 480 MW to 510 MW for the quarter ending March 31, 2016 and 2.6 GW to 3.0 GW for the fiscal year ending December 31, 2016. The Company also expects its gross margin in the first quart of 2016 to be in the estimated range of 17 % to 19%.
